About The Show

Jackie Robinson's 1946 season with the Montreal Royals shattered the color bar in baseball, redefined Canada's cultural identity and foreshadowed the revolutionary events of America's civil rights movement. This is a portrait of Robinson, a man who kept his dignity and poise while enduring Jim Crow-typre segregation from his white teammates and racial taunts from fans and other players.
